Heavy Sword

The Heavy Sword was a flat, double-edged sword used in 5th century BCE Greece. It weighed more than other, similar swords, earning it its name.

During the Peloponnesian War, the Spartan misthios Kassandra found this sword in the inventories of blacksmiths and looted it from bodies and chests during her travels throughout Greece.[1]
